Šablónové archívy Šablónový archív sa vytvárajú vytvára nad Definíciami zariadení Definíciou zariadenia (resp. nad konkrétnymi položkami definície zariadenízariadenia) a nad inými šablónovými archívmi. Ich cieľom Cieľom šablónového archívu je vytvorenie šablóny konfigurácie archívneho objektu nad Definíciou zariadenia. Na základe tejto šablóny vytvorí proces D2000 Archív inštancie šablóny pre všetky Zariadenia, ktoré majú túto Definíciu zariadenia.
...
- Archivovať hodnoty objektov (primárne archívy)- archivovanie položiek Definície zariadenia. Archivovanie môže byť periodické alebo pri zmene hodnoty.
- Prepočet zaarchivovaných hodnôt štatistickou funkciou (štatistické archívy) - umožňuje prepočet hodnôt definovaného šablónového objektu štatistickou funkciou.
- Prepočet zaarchivovaných hodnôt zadaným výrazom (vypočítané archívy) - prepočet archívnych objektov definovaných vo výraze. Výpočtom sa získajú hodnoty, ktoré sú následne archivované.
- Archív plnený skriptom (Sklad hodnôt) - plnenie hodnôt je možné buď z ESL skriptu alebo manuálne prostredníctvom procesu D2000 HI.
...
- Musí byť zaškrtnutá voľba "Zverejňovať hodnoty".
- Musí byť zadaný Cieľový objekt (prípadne Cieľový stĺpec alebo Cieľová štruktúra), ktorým je položka Definície zariadenia (napr. DD DD.Generator^PowerArc).
- Meno šablónového archívu je odvodený odvodené od mena Definície zariadenia a mena položky nakonfigurovanej ako Cieľový objekt (napr. ak Cieľový objekt je DD.Generator^PowerArc, meno šablónového archívu bude DDbude DD.Generator.PowerArc).
Pozn: táto vlastnosť automaticky zabezpečí, že nedôjde omylom k zverejneniu iného šablónového archívu (prípadne iného šablónového počítaného bodu) do tej istej položky. - Prístup k archívnym hodnotám (z ESL skriptu, z procesu HI, z grafu atď) je pomocou položky konkrétneho Zariadenia (nakonfigurovanej ako Cieľový objekt), ktoré má túto Definíciu zariadenia (napr. DI.Generator1^PowerArc).
Kotvaarchivovat_hodnoty_objektov archivovat_hodnoty_objektov
ARCHIVOVAŤ HODNOTY OBJEKTOV
archivovat_hodnoty_objektov | |
archivovat_hodnoty_objektov |
...
Archivovaným objektom, alebo zdrojom hodnôt musí byť položka zariadenia (napr. DD.Generator^Power).
Cieľový objekt musí byť položka Definície zariadenia (napr. DD DD.Generator^PowerArc) - musí sa jednať o tú istú Definíciu zariadenia, ktorá je nakonfigurovaná ako Archivovaný objekt (ale samozrejme stĺpec musí byť iný).
Obr 1: príklad konfigurácie šablónového primárneho archívu DD DD.Generator.PowerArc, ktorý archivuje položku Power z Definície zariadenia DD DD.Generator a zverejňuje ju do položky PowerArc položky PowerArc tej istej Definície zariadenia DD.Generator. Kotva obr1 obr1
...
Tento archív umožňuje definovanie šablónového štatistického archívu, ktorý zabezpečuje výpočet štatistickej funkcie nad primárnym šablónovýho iným zdrojovým archívom .- Archívnym objektom, ktorý musí byť iný šablónový archív.
Cieľový objekt musí byť položka Definície zariadenia (napr. DD DD.Generator^PowerArcAvg) - musí sa jednať o tú istú Definíciu zariadenia, ktorú mať ako Cieľový má ako Cieľový objekt zdrojový archív nakonfigurovaný ako Archívny objekt (ale samozrejme stĺpec musí byť iný).
Obr 2: príklad konfigurácie šablónového štatistického archívu DD.Generator.PowerArcAvg, ktorý vypočítava štatistiku nad šablónovým archívom DD.Generator.PowerArc (viď Obr1) a zverejňuje ju do položky PowerArcAvg položky PowerArcAvg Definície zariadenia DD DD.Generator. Kotva obr2 obr2
Kotvaprepocet_zad_vyrazom prepocet_zad_vyrazom
PREPOČET ZAARCHIVOVANÝCH HODNÔT ZADANÝM VÝRAZOM
prepocet_zad_vyrazom | |
prepocet_zad_vyrazom |
...
- vo výraze sa môžu vyskytovať iba šablónové archívy pracujúce s tou istou Definíciou zariadenia, ktorá je nakonfigurovaná ako Cieľový stĺpec tohto šablónového archívu
- vo výraze sa môžu vyskytovať iné, ne-šablónové archívy. Nesmú sa ale vyskytovať položky štruktúrovaných archívov s nulovým indexom (napr. H.MyStruct[0]^Col1 alebo H alebo H.MyStructCol[0])
Kotvaarchiv_plneny_skriptom archiv_plneny_skriptom
ARCHÍV PLNENÝ SKRIPTOM (SKLAD HODNÔT)
archiv_plneny_skriptom | |
archiv_plneny_skriptom |
Tento archív umožňuje definovanie šablónového skladu hodnôt. Pri konfigurácii skladu hodnôt sa nezadáva zdroj, Cieľová štruktúra musí byť položka Definície zariadenia (napr. DD DD.Generator^PlanArc).
Obr 4: príklad konfigurácie šablónového skladu hodnôt DD DD.Generator.PlanArc, ktorý zverejňuje hodnoty do položky PlanArc položky PlanArc Definície zariadenia DD DD.Generator. Kotva obr4 obr4
Info | ||
---|---|---|
| ||
...